Gaushala skill development report Samast Mahajan, a leading NGO in the field of animal welfare and rural development, implemented an extensive skill development initiative in FY 2023–24 across 1,065 Gaushalas in Maharashtra.The primary objective was to empower Gaushala workers, especially women and youth, by equipping them with knowledge and practical skills to produce organic and eco-friendly products derived from indigenous cow resources – primarily cow dung (Gobar) and cow urine (Gomutra).
